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1805649042 75 00187 2469531
32052775815 76892 584151
32052775815 76892 584151
604 13 54 59390319267
All about undefined
Interested in learning more?
32052775815 76892 584151
604 13 54 59390319267
See more
7820027 34 8119316
183 812 535 3164745 24902
See more
078964 87599010
3291 8265577 6179
See more